What is a drilling optimization engineer?

Drilling Optimization Engineers are professionals in the oil and gas industry responsible for improving the efficiency, safety, and cost-effectiveness of drilling operations. They analyze data from drilling sites, recommend adjustments to drilling parameters, and coll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to optimize drilling performance. Their work includes selecting appropriate drilling technologies,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ring best practices are followed throughout the drilling process. The ultimate goal is to minimize non-productive time and maximize well productivity while maintaining safety and environmental standards.

How does a drilling optimization engineer typically collaborate with drilling teams and other departments on a project?

A Drilling Optimization Engineer works closely with drilling teams, geologists, and data analysts to ensure efficient and safe drilling operations. They analyze real-time drilling data, recommend adjustments to parameters, and participate in daily meetings to discuss progress and address challenges. Effective communication is essential, as they often serve as a bridge between field operations and engineering teams, ensuring that best practices and innovative solutions are implemented across the project.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a drilling optimization eng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Drilling Optimization Engineer, you need a solid background in petroleum engineering, drilling operations, and data analysis, often supported by a relevant engineering degree. Familiarity with drilling simulation software, real-time data monitoring systems, and industry certifications such as IWCF or Well Control are typ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and teamwork skills are crucial for collaborating with multidisciplinary teams and making informed decisions quickly. These competencies are vital for ensuring drilling efficiency, minimizing operational risks, and achieving cost-effective project outcomes.

What is the difference between Drilling Optimization Engineer vs Drilling Engineer?

AspectDrilling Optimization EngineerDrilling Engineer
CredentialsBachelor's degree in Petroleum Engineering or related field; certifications in drilling practicesBachelor's degree in Petroleum Engineering or related field; similar certifications
Work EnvironmentFocus on optimizing drilling processes, data analysis, and efficiency improvementsOversees entire drilling operations, including planning, execution, and safety
Industry UsagePrimarily in companies seeking to improve drilling performance and reduce costsInvolved in all aspects of drilling projects, from design to execution

While both roles require similar educational backgrounds and certifications, the Drilling Optimization Engineer specializes in enhancing drilling efficiency through data analysis and process improvements. The Drilling Engineer oversees the entire drilling operation, ensuring safety and project success. The optimization engineer's role is more focused on technical analysis and performance enhancement within the broader drilling process.
